Ovoviviparity, ovovivipary, ovivipary, or aplacental viviparity is a term used as a "bridging" form of reproduction between egg-laying oviparous and live-bearing viviparous reproduction. Ovoviviparous animals possess embryos that develop inside eggs that remain in the mother's body until they are ready to hatch.

Ovoviviparous and viviparous fish compared [ edit ] Most of the Poeciliidae are ovoviviparous , that is, while the eggs are retained inside the body of the female for protection, the eggs are essentially independent of the mother and she does not provide them with any nutrients.
